:root {
    --base-font-factor: 1;
    --media-scale-factor: 1;
}

.responsive-text {
    font-size: calc(clamp(var(--min-font-size), calc(var(--scale-factor) * var(--base-font-factor)), var(--max-font-size)) * var(--media-scale-factor));
}

.responsive-element {
    transform: scale(calc(var(--scale-factor) * var(--media-scale-factor)));
}